Understand importance of languages in our country: LG Sinha

Says no nation can match diversity in languages like India

Srinagar: Lieutenant Governor Manoj Sinha on Friday called on the youngsters to understand the importance of languages in our country.

Addressing the inaugural session of national seminar’Bhartiya Bhashaon Mein Ekaatmata’ at NIT here, LG Sinha, according to the news agency—Kashmir News Observer (KNO) said, “No country in the world can match the diversity in languages we have. Its our duty to save the Hindi language under Hindi Pakhwada initiative.”

“Youngsters need to understand the importance of languages in our country,” tge LG said adding NIT students and professors have to make sure to get rid of the colonial mind set and embrace our languages.

He said, “Today, we feel a strong need to inspire the country with an ideology of development. India or Developed India, I think, is not just a slogan, it’s an ideology, a movement. Our common goal should be that by the time we celebrate the centenary of our independence in 2047, we should see India as a united nation.”

“In this movement, there can be different cultural foundations, people speaking different languages, but I would especially like to say to the students of the National Institute of Technology, where this program is taking place, that you will have to make a very important contribution. To create a resurgent India, you will have to strive to live your life to the fullest and move forward to completely eliminate every vestige of slavery and build a glorious India.”

The LG Sinha said, “We need to know the needs of society, understand them, live for them, and be prepared to sacrifice everything for our goal. In this campaign, we will have to always keep in mind that this is a prophecy written on stone, which will certainly come true. The wheel of time has turned, and that India, which once had a larger share in world GDP than all the countries of America and Europe combined, and which gave the world a new system of knowledge through mathematics and science, that India is once again moving forward to regain its old glory.”

“Today, the whole world is looking towards India with great expectations for the future. It depends on how actively our youth can play a role in shaping policies and guiding India, not just India but the world, through their abilities, innovations, and research. I would also like to mention in today’s program that our policymakers should always focus on inclusive development,”LG Sinha said—(KNO)
